Under the Credentialing Logistics and Information Manager's direction, the Credentials Coordinator II (Verification) works cooperatively with the Credentials Coordinator I and Credentials Analysts to ensure the seamless and timely flow of credentialing-related information to meet appointment and reappointment deadlines and qualitative requirements. Incumbents participate in the credentialing functions' effective day-to-day operations and provide recommendations to enhance productivity to meet targeted service levels, turnaround times, and satisfaction/quality levels. Incumbents also assist in the research and analysis of credentials files to complete SBARs for senior management and leadership for the Credentials Analysts. The Credentials Coordinator II will also maintain the provider database's integrity for accurate display of information and accurate reports regarding credentialed providers and provide input for process design and other implementation activities.
Primary Duties and Responsibilities:
- Maintains constructive communication with Intake Coordinator and provides feedback, coaching, education and requests for rework or additional information regarding work products that do not conform with established organizational requirements for being deemed a complete application.
- Obtains verifications from authorized sources in conformance with established procedures. Follows standard operating procedures to ensure that the proper process has been followed when obtaining a verification.
- Responds to practitioner issues and concerns and advises Credentials Analyst of alternatives in attempting to meet and resolve them.
- Data entry, scanning or import of verification data in conformance with established expectations for format and entry of data into software (MSOW)
- Adheres to scope, timeliness and sequence of processing in accordance with departmental standards, which are imbedded in the Morrisey work processes, jobs and tasks set-up, as well as Medical Staff Bylaws and related policies.
- Evaluate responses for identification of potentially adverse information. Application of established flagging criteria to verification responses for consideration in subsequent processing phases.
- Worklists files that deemed to meet required specifications for a complete file or an exhausted effort to Credentials Analysts (Quality Control). Performs additional work on or rework on files referred from Credentials Analyst.
- Monitors currency of credentials in conformance with established procedures including notifications to practitioner or other departments regarding delinquency and automatic suspension. Monitors disciplinary actions.
- Performs other duties as needed, to ensure that material is processed timely and accurately.
- Takes direction from and collaborates with the Credentials Analyst (Quality Control) to assist in resolution and escalation of issues.
